Airbnb's Top Stability & Growth Strengths
Strong Revenue Growth: Recent results show full-year 2025 revenue rose to about $12.2B with Q4 2025 revenue up roughly 12% alongside GBV growth of about 12% for the year and about 16% in Q4. Management’s 2026 outlook calls for at least low double‑digit revenue growth with Q1 2026 guided to approximately 14–16%.
Strong Market Position & Advantage: The company is characterized as a category leader in dedicated short‑term rentals, with brand strength and scale evidenced by hundreds of millions of Nights & Experiences and expanding GBV. Commentary notes Airbnb remains the largest dedicated home‑sharing marketplace even as leadership is contested on broader OTA metrics.
Market Expansion: Late‑2025 momentum was highlighted in Brazil and Japan, with India among the fastest‑growing origin markets and expansion markets growing faster than core. Geographic breadth helped deliver the fastest quarterly GBV growth in over two years exiting 2025.
